astralaaron Posted September 6, 2008 Share Posted September 6, 2008 http://www.research.att.com/~ttsweb/tts/demo.phpit's a text-to-speech on a website...but my real question is: is it possible to have microphone communication through a website?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Ingolme Posted September 6, 2008 Share Posted September 6, 2008 They have programmed an application on the server side (most likely with some CGI language) that reads text and creates sound files.It would probably have a whole library of syllables and take them according to the received text.You can use Java or Flash to make microphone communication using sockets to connect to an application on the server.
